Liver transplantation has currently become an important treatment for patients with end-stage liver disease or hepatocellular carcinoma(HCC),significantly improving patients'prognosis.However,liver transplantation still facing many challenges,such as donor sources,liver preservation technology,transplant rejection,biliary complications and postoperative tumor recurrence after HCC liver transplantation,which urgently need to be solved and optimized.With the development of new technologies,liver transplantation in our country is facing new opportunities and challenges.Domestic research teams actively respond to the needs of the times and continuously promote innovation and breakthroughs in the basic research of liver transplantation.This article reviews the cutting-edge progress in the field of basic liver transplantation research in 2024 and evaluates the important research achievements obtained by Chinese research teams in this field.The systematic sorting out of these research advances not only helps to promote the integration of Chinese characteristic liver transplantation research into the international academic system and the docking of Chinese liver transplantation research with the global forefront,but also helps researchers and clinical surgeons to fully understand the current status of basic liver transplantation research in China,provides a clear direction for future basic research,and thus promotes the vigorous development of Chinese liver transplantation cause.关键词
